Java Insert JTable Rows Data Into MySQL - Hallo sahabat Dev-Create, Pada Artikel yang anda baca kali ini dengan judul Java Insert JTable Rows Data Into MySQL, kami telah mempersiapkan artikel ini dengan baik untuk anda baca dan ambil informasi didalamnya. mudah-mudahan isi postingan Artikel insert, Artikel Insert All JTable Rows Data To MySQL DataBase Using Java, Artikel Insert JTable Data Into MySQL, Artikel Java, Artikel java jtable, Artikel jtable, Artikel jtable row, yang kami tulis ini dapat anda pahami. baiklah, selamat membaca.

Judul : Java Insert JTable Rows Data Into MySQL
link : Java Insert JTable Rows Data Into MySQL

Baca juga


Java Insert JTable Rows Data Into MySQL

How To Insert All JTable Rows Data To MySQL DataBase Using Java NetBeans

Insert JTable Values Into DataBase Using Java



In this Java Tutorial we will see How To INSERT All JTable Rows Values Into DataBase Using For Loop And addBatch Function On Button Click In Java NetBeans .




▶ Download All JAVA Projects Source Code


Project Source Code:


// function to get the connection
    public Connection getConnection()
    {
         try {
            Class.forName("com.mysql.jdbc.Driver");
        } catch (ClassNotFoundException ex) {
             System.out.println(ex.getMessage());
        }
        
        Connection con = null;
        
        try {
            con = DriverManager.getConnection("jdbc:mysql://localhost/s_t_d", "root", "");
        } catch (SQLException ex) {
            System.out.println(ex.getMessage());
        }
        return con;
    } 


// insert button
    private void jButtonInsertActionPerformed(java.awt.event.ActionEvent evt) {                                              
        
        Connection con = getConnection();
        Statement st;
        
        DefaultTableModel model = (DefaultTableModel) jTable1.getModel();
        
        try {
            st = con.createStatement();
            
            for(int i = 0; i < model.getRowCount(); i++){
                
                int id = Integer.valueOf(model.getValueAt(i, 0).toString());
                String fn = model.getValueAt(i, 1).toString();
                String adr = model.getValueAt(i, 2).toString();
                String bdate = model.getValueAt(i, 3).toString();
                
                String sqlQuery = "INSERT INTO `student`(`Id`, `FullName`, `Address`, `BirthDate`) VALUES ("+id+",'"+fn+"','"+adr+"','"+bdate+"')";
                
                st.addBatch(sqlQuery);
            }
            
            int[] rowsInserted = st.executeBatch();
            System.out.println("Data Inserted");
            System.out.println("rowsInserted Count = " + rowsInserted.length);
            
        } catch (SQLException ex) {
            Logger.getLogger(Insert_All_JTable_Row_Into_MySQL.class.getName()).log(Level.SEVERE, null, ex);
        }
        
    }

OutPut:

java add jtable data to mysql






Demikianlah Artikel Java Insert JTable Rows Data Into MySQL

Sekianlah artikel Java Insert JTable Rows Data Into MySQL kali ini, mudah-mudahan bisa memberi manfaat untuk anda semua. baiklah, sampai jumpa di postingan artikel lainnya.

Anda sekarang membaca artikel Java Insert JTable Rows Data Into MySQL dengan alamat link https://dev-create.blogspot.com/2021/05/java-insert-jtable-rows-data-into-mysql.html